Naveen: Meaning, Sanskrit Origin, and Cultural Significance
What Does Naveen Mean?
The name Naveen (नवीन) is a direct Sanskrit word meaning "new," "fresh," "modern," "young," or "novel." It is derived from the root "Nava" (नव), which means new.
